Output dbc3a0364500fde682296375ce90f54a08dcec41670671d4abae1430f8c403b8:1

value
2910693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c36bd4051eb2563e7f8cc65d8a6b986823150f68 OP_EQUAL
address
3KWJrz7khbn6Tkp2AE7fGp2QE4hTa6bAaZ
transaction
dbc3a0364500fde682296375ce90f54a08dcec41670671d4abae1430f8c403b8
spent
true